Hydronic Control Market Dynamics
DRIVER
"Growing demand for energy-efficient building solutions."
One of the main drivers of the hydronic control market is the increasing push for energy efficiency in commercial and residential sectors. In 2024, buildings accounted for 36% of global energy consumption, with heating and cooling contributing nearly 48% of that demand. Hydronic systems reduce energy consumption by 26% compared to traditional HVAC systems. Europe led installations with 18 million units deployed in 2024, driven by regulatory energy efficiency mandates. North America followed with 12.4 million installations, where hospitals and healthcare contributed 18% of hydronic system demand. Governments worldwide are enforcing stricter guidelines, making hydronic controls essential for sustainable building projects.
RESTRAINT
"High installation and integration costs."
Despite energy savings, high upfront costs remain a restraint in the hydronic control market. Nearly 43% of small contractors worldwide identified cost as the biggest barrier to adoption in 2024. The average installation of hydronic systems costs 27% more compared to conventional HVAC alternatives. In Latin America, only 9% of new commercial projects integrated hydronic systems due to capital constraints. Africa reported similarly limited adoption, with only 60,000 units installed in 2024 across the continent. Maintenance and integration with legacy systems further increase costs, reducing adoption rates in small-scale residential projects. This cost factor remains a hurdle for wider market penetration.

Valves: Valves represented 29% of the hydronic control market in 2024, equal to 13.2 million units installed globally. Valves play a crucial role in regulating flow within hydronic systems, ensuring balanced heating and cooling distribution. Europe installed 4.6 million units, followed by Asia-Pacific with 4.1 million and North America with 3.2 million. Valves are increasingly integrated with smart sensors for remote monitoring and predictive maintenance, making them essential in both residential and commercial projects.

Flow Controllers: Flow controllers accounted for 18% of hydronic system installations in 2024, representing more than 8 million units deployed. These devices ensure proper water flow and pressure within hydronic networks, maintaining efficiency and preventing energy waste. Asia-Pacific accounted for 3.2 million installations, with China and India as key contributors. Europe deployed 2.6 million units, while North America installed 1.9 million. The growth of industrial facilities and commercial complexes globally has increased reliance on flow controllers to stabilize operations.
